Overview

High-efficiency passivators are specialized chemical formulations designed to enhance the corrosion resistance of metals by forming a thin, protective layer on their surfaces. This process, known as passivation, significantly extends the lifespan of metal components in harsh environments. These agents are particularly valuable in industries where metal durability is critical, such as automotive manufacturing, aerospace engineering, and infrastructure development. The technology has evolved to include eco-friendly formulations that meet stringent environmental regulations while maintaining high performance standards.

Physical and Chemical Properties

The physical properties of high-efficiency passivators vary depending on their specific formulation. Most commercial products are liquid solutions with densities slightly higher than water, while some specialized formulations come in powder form for specific applications. Chemically, these agents typically contain oxidizing compounds that react with the metal surface to create a stable, non-reactive oxide layer. Modern formulations often include organic additives that enhance film formation and improve adhesion to the metal substrate. The pH of these solutions is carefully controlled to ensure optimal performance without damaging the base material.

Main Applications

In the automotive industry, high-efficiency passivators are extensively used for treating vehicle chassis, exhaust systems, and other components exposed to road salts and moisture. The aerospace sector relies on these compounds for protecting aircraft aluminum alloys from atmospheric corrosion. The construction industry employs passivation treatments for structural steel and reinforcement bars in concrete. Recent developments have expanded applications to include electronic components and medical devices, where surface stability is crucial for performance and safety.

Safety and Storage

While generally less hazardous than traditional acid-based passivation methods, high-efficiency passivators still require proper handling precautions. Workers should use appropriate personal protective equipment, including nitrile gloves and safety goggles, when handling concentrated solutions. Storage conditions are critical for maintaining product effectiveness. Most liquid formulations should be kept in sealed containers at temperatures between 5°C and 30°C. Manufacturers typically recommend using opened containers within six months to prevent degradation of active components. Special attention should be paid to preventing contamination from other chemicals.

B2B Procurement Guide

When procuring high-efficiency passivators in bulk, buyers should first verify the compatibility with their specific metal substrates. Technical datasheets should be requested to confirm performance characteristics under expected service conditions. Quality certifications such as ISO 9001 and environmental compliance (REACH, RoHS) should be prioritized. For large-volume purchases, consider negotiating long-term supply agreements with performance guarantees. Testing small batches before full-scale implementation is strongly recommended to ensure the product meets application requirements.
